I just ordered an Infinity ErgoDox keyboard from Massdrop.  Here's hoping I can find a layout that is satisfactory for programming and doesn't break my muscle memory too substantially, while helping with reach pain from using horribly placed modifier keys on standard keyboards.  I guess I'll find out some time around the end of summer, which is the estimated delivery.  :-/
